I have a question about pfFog.

How is the density parameter required for glFog calculated from pfFog's opaque
distance when I use PFFOG_*_EXP* fog?

I know that the fog factor of GL_FOG_EXP type is calculated as follows:

f = e^(-density * z)

No matter how you specify the density, it can never output 0.
But, according to the man page, the opaque distance of pfFog means the distance
at which f=0...
